Title: The Innovations of Patrick Casey in Oral Care
Introduction
Patrick Casey is an accomplished inventor based in Hoboken, NJ (US). He has made significant contributions to the field of oral care through his innovative designs and patents. His work focuses on improving the effectiveness and usability of oral care implements.
Latest Patents
Patrick Casey holds a patent for an oral care implement. This invention includes a handle and a head with a base structure. A plurality of cleaning elements is attached to the base structure, with one end of each cleaning element connected to one another. Notably, at least one of the cleaning elements is designed as a spiral bristle. This innovative design aims to enhance the cleaning efficiency of oral care products.
Career Highlights
Patrick Casey is currently employed at Colgate-Palmolive Company, a leading global consumer products company known for its oral care products. His role at the company allows him to apply his inventive skills to develop new and improved oral care solutions.
Collaborations
Throughout his career, Patrick has collaborated with talented individuals such as Eduardo J. Jimenez and Douglas J. Hohlbein. These collaborations have contributed to the advancement of oral care technologies and the successful development of innovative products.
